Eye conditions have their specific symptoms (which is beneficial as part of a diagnosis). However, the majority of general symptoms permits us to denote whether a problem or weakenss has arisen and allow us to take both treatment advice and preventative action.
Symptoms pertaining to eye health problems include:
- Blurred vision
- Vision distortion
- Pain and redness in or around the eye
- Night blindness, visual field constriction
- Excess tearing, stinging, itching or light sensitivity
- Red, swollen eyes or lids, dry eyes, eyelid or eye crusting.
- Glare from artificial light, dull colours
- A ‘waterfall’ or ‘halo’ effect in the peripheral vision
- Watery discharge
- Heaviness
- Increased floaters
- Light flashes
- Corneal crystals (yellow, shiny deposits on the retina)
- Headaches or tired eyes.
- Mouth sores, inflammation in the eye and skin problems are also associated.
